Output 93d24b266711cf45758a403a0becfbf3b17c70dc5aff1b80c6d65067de105c26:3

value
845308
script pubkey
OP_0 OP_PUSHBYTES_20 51c3bc49dd8e2fd1bddf9dd2bdc67b8c9ee8f57a
address
bc1q28pmcjwa3char0wlnhftm3nm3j0w3at6pt2tz2
transaction
93d24b266711cf45758a403a0becfbf3b17c70dc5aff1b80c6d65067de105c26
spent
true